微信多人区块链竞猜应用,开发与应用前景解析微信多人区块链竞猜app怎么样
本文目录导读:
随着区块链技术的快速发展,区块链应用逐渐突破了传统的局限,进入了更多创新领域,区块链竞猜应用作为一种新兴的娱乐形式,凭借其高趣味性和社交属性,受到了广泛关注,而微信作为中国最大的社交平台,拥有庞大的用户基础和技术生态,为区块链竞猜应用的开发和推广提供了得天独厚的条件,本文将从多个角度探讨微信多人区块链竞猜应用的开发可能性、技术实现以及未来前景。
区块链竞猜应用的概述
区块链,全称加密货币区块链,是一种去中心化的分布式账本系统,记录着所有交易的全过程,区块链具有不可篡改、不可伪造、可追溯等特点,这些特性使其在多个领域得到了广泛应用。
区块链竞猜应用是一种基于区块链技术的娱乐形式,参与者通过参与竞猜活动,获得奖励,这种应用不仅可以娱乐,还可以实现一定的收益,用户可以通过参与彩票、投资预测等竞猜活动,获得一定的收益。
区块链竞猜应用的核心在于利用区块链技术实现交易的透明性和不可篡改性,通过区块链技术,可以确保竞猜活动的公正性,防止中间人 manipulating。
微信生态与区块链竞猜应用的结合
微信作为中国最大的社交平台,拥有超过10亿的用户数量,微信的用户基础广,且用户活跃度高,这为区块链竞猜应用的推广提供了广阔的市场空间,微信的生态系统包括微信支付、微信支付、微信 Games 等功能,为区块链竞猜应用的开发提供了便利。
微信的用户基础和生态系统为区块链竞猜应用的开发提供了天然的优势,开发者可以利用微信的用户基础,快速推广应用;微信的支付系统可以为应用提供资金支持;微信的社交功能可以增强应用的互动性。
微信的生态系统的开放性也为区块链竞猜应用的开发提供了技术支持,开发者可以利用微信的开发工具和生态系统,快速开发和部署应用。
微信多人区块链竞猜应用的开发流程
技术选型
在开发微信多人区块链竞猜应用时,需要根据应用的功能需求选择合适的技术 stack,以下是常见的技术选型:
- 前端开发:React Native 或者 Flutter 是常用的移动开发框架,可以快速开发跨平台应用。
- 后端开发:Node.js 或者 Python 是常用的后端开发框架,可以为应用提供高效的处理能力。
- 数据库设计:MySQL 或者 MongoDB 是常用的数据库,可以根据应用的需求选择合适的数据存储方式。
- 区块链技术:以太坊 或者 Ethereum 是常用的区块链平台,可以为应用提供区块链功能。
前端开发
前端开发是应用开发的重要环节,在微信多人区块链竞猜应用中,前端需要实现用户注册、游戏规则、智能合约等核心功能,以下是前端开发的具体步骤:
- 用户注册:用户需要通过手机号和密码注册账号,微信的用户可以通过微信登录,简化注册流程。
- 游戏规则:应用需要提供清晰的游戏规则,包括竞猜内容、规则、奖励等,规则需要通过区块链技术实现透明性和公正性。
- 智能合约:智能合约是区块链应用的核心功能,在竞猜应用中,智能合约可以用来记录竞猜结果、支付奖励等。
后端开发
后端开发是应用开发的另一重要环节,在微信多人区块链竞猜应用中,后端需要处理用户数据、支付接口、智能合约等,以下是后端开发的具体步骤:
- 用户数据管理:后端需要管理用户数据,包括用户信息、竞猜记录等,可以通过数据库实现数据的存储和管理。
- 支付接口对接:应用需要对接微信支付接口,为用户提供支付功能,支付接口对接需要遵循微信支付的 API 要求。
- 智能合约实现:智能合约可以通过以太坊平台实现,后端需要编写智能合约代码,并部署到以太坊区块链上。
数据库设计
数据库设计是应用开发的关键环节,在微信多人区块链竞猜应用中,数据库需要支持用户数据、竞猜记录、支付记录等,以下是数据库设计的具体步骤:
- 用户表:用户表需要存储用户的基本信息,包括手机号、密码、注册时间等。
- 竞猜记录表:竞猜记录表需要存储用户参与的竞猜记录,包括竞猜内容、竞猜结果、用户ID等。
- 支付记录表:支付记录表需要存储用户支付的记录,包括支付金额、支付时间、支付方式等。
智能合约实现
智能合约是区块链应用的核心功能,在微信多人区块链竞猜应用中,智能合约可以用来记录竞猜结果、支付奖励等,以下是智能合约实现的具体步骤:
- 智能合约编写:智能合约可以通过以太坊平台编写,开发者需要编写智能合约的代码,并通过以太坊区块链部署。
- 智能合约部署:智能合约部署需要选择合适的以太坊节点,确保智能合约的安全性和稳定性。
- 智能合约验证:智能合约需要通过验证,确保其逻辑正确,没有漏洞。
微信多人区块链竞猜应用的开发要点
用户注册与登录
用户注册是应用的起点,在微信多人区块链竞猜应用中,用户可以通过微信登录,简化注册流程,注册流程需要包括手机号验证、密码设置、邮箱验证等,为了提高安全性,还可以对注册流程进行多因素认证。
游戏规则与竞猜内容
游戏规则是应用的核心,在微信多人区块链竞猜应用中,游戏规则需要清晰明了,包括竞猜内容、竞猜时间、竞猜方式等,竞猜内容可以是彩票、投资预测、体育赛事等,竞猜结果需要通过区块链技术实现透明性和公正性。
智能合约的实现
智能合约是应用的核心功能,在微信多人区块链竞猜应用中,智能合约可以用来记录竞猜结果、支付奖励等,智能合约需要通过以太坊平台实现,确保其安全性和稳定性。
支付接口对接
支付是用户参与竞猜的重要环节,在微信多人区块链竞猜应用中,支付接口需要对接微信支付接口,为用户提供便捷的支付方式,支付接口对接需要遵循微信支付的 API 要求,确保支付过程的安全性和高效性。
数据分析与反馈
数据分析是应用的重要功能,在微信多人区块链竞猜应用中,数据分析可以用来统计用户行为、竞猜结果等,数据分析结果可以通过图表、报告等形式展示给用户,数据分析还可以用来优化应用的功能,提升用户体验。
微信多人区块链竞猜应用的前景
市场需求
随着区块链技术的快速发展,区块链应用的需求也在不断增加,微信作为中国最大的社交平台,拥有庞大的用户基础,为区块链应用的推广提供了天然的市场空间,微信多人区块链竞猜应用作为一种娱乐形式,具有高趣味性和社交属性,市场需求巨大。
技术可行性
区块链技术已经成熟,且在多个领域得到了广泛应用,微信的生态系统也为区块链应用的开发提供了便利,微信多人区块链竞猜应用的技术可行性非常高,可以通过现有技术实现。
潜在风险
尽管微信多人区块链竞猜应用具有较高的前景,但也存在一些潜在风险,智能合约的安全性是一个重要问题,如果智能合约出现漏洞,可能导致用户资金损失,应用的运营成本也是一个需要考虑的问题,微信多人区块链竞猜应用需要投入大量的资源进行推广和运营。
未来发展方向
微信多人区块链竞猜应用可以朝着以下几个方向发展:
- 丰富竞猜内容:增加更多种类的竞猜活动,满足用户的需求。
- 增强社交属性:通过社交功能,增强用户的互动性和参与感。
- 优化用户体验:通过数据分析和反馈,优化应用的功能,提升用户体验。
- 拓展应用场景:将区块链竞猜应用拓展到其他领域,如教育、医疗等。
微信多人区块链竞猜应用是一种结合了区块链技术和社交平台的创新应用,通过区块链技术实现交易的透明性和不可篡改性,结合微信的用户基础和生态系统,可以开发出有趣且具有商业价值的应用,尽管存在一些潜在风险,但微信多人区块链竞猜应用的前景非常广阔,开发者可以通过不断优化应用功能,满足用户需求,推动区块链应用的进一步发展。
微信多人区块链竞猜应用,开发与应用前景解析微信多人区块链竞猜app怎么样,
发表评论